370
CFML Language Reference
GetTickCount
Returns a millisecond clock counter that can be used for timing sections of CFML code
or any other aspects of page processing.
Syntax
GetTickCount
()
Usage
The absolute value of the counter has no meaning. Generate useful timing values by
taking differences between the results of GetTickCount() at specified points during
page processing.
Examples
<!--- This example calls the GetTickCount
function to track execution time --->
<HTML>
<BODY>
<!--- Setup timing test --->
<CFSET iterationCount = 1000>
<!--- Time an empty loop with this many iterations --->
<CFSET tickBegin = GetTickCount()>
<CFLOOP Index=i From=1 To=#iterationCount#></CFLOOP>
<CFSET tickEnd = GetTickCount()>
<CFSET loopTime = tickEnd - tickBegin>
<!--- Report --->
<CFOUTPUT>Loop time (#iterationCount# iterations) was: #loopTime#
milliseconds</CFOUTPUT>
</BODY>
</HTML>
Summary of Contents for COLDFUSION 4.5-CFML LANGUAGE
Page 1: ...Allaire Corporation CFML Language Reference ColdFusion 4 5...
Page 207: ...Chapter 1 ColdFusion Tags 183 CFCATCH CFTRY BODY HTML...
Page 224: ...200 CFMLLanguageReference CFOUTPUT P Text within CFOUTPUT is always shown CFOUTPUT BODY HTML...
Page 336: ...312 CFMLLanguageReference CFIF BODY HTML...
Page 404: ...380 CFMLLanguageReference DE It is morning CFOUTPUT P BODY HTML...
Page 413: ...Chapter 2 ColdFusion Functions 389 Customer BalanceDue BR CFOUTPUT CFIF BODY HTML...
Page 483: ...Chapter 2 ColdFusion Functions 459 CFOUTPUT CFLOOP BODY HTML...
Page 584: ...560 CFMLLanguageReference...
Page 594: ...570 CFMLLanguageReference...